WebOct 28, 2024 · A recent study built upon previous research that showed tea can help lower blood pressure. The researchers were looking for why tea has this effect on blood pressure. 7 The study found that two specific compounds affect a type of protein (called KCNQ5) found in the smooth muscle that lines blood vessels. WebImpact Daily consumption of 5-6 cups of green tea could result in reductions in systolic blood pressure, total cholesterol, and LDL cholesterol. Green tea should not be recommended as a substitute for current management of patients with established hypertension or dyslipidaemia.
